Impending Winter Weather
Date Posted: Friday, January 23rd, 2026
The City is monitoring the impending weekend winter weather, which includes extremely cold temperatures and heavy snowfall of several inches, from late Saturday evening through Monday.
To support public safety and snow removal operations, residents are asked to:
- Avoid travel and stay off the roads if possible.
- Do not push or shovel snow into roadways.
- Keep snow clear of home vent pipes and exhaust vents.
- Check on neighbors who may need assistance during extreme cold.
- If off-street parking is available, please move vehicles, if possible, to facilitate plowing.
- Please make sure you remove any snow or ice from sidewalk within 24 hours of the end of the storm.
- Register for Code Red notifications for alerts related to the storm, public safety, trash removal, etc. .
Public Works crews will be working throughout the storm to keep main roads and emergency routes open. Please be patient during snow removal efforts, as poor road conditions are expected and post-storm cleanup may take time.
